Body Discovered in Provo River Identified
February 15th, 2007 @ 12:00pm

PROVO, Utah (AP) -- A body found floating in the Provo River was identified Tuesday as an 18-year-old local man.

"It was just sticking out of the water," said Shiree Russell, 14, who saw the fully clothed body Monday on the way home from Independence High School.

"I didn't know what to do, so I ran back to school and called my mom," Shiree said.

Police identified the young man as Anthony Abeyta of Provo. Officers were awaiting the results of an autopsy. There were no obvious wounds.

"It doesn't appear to be suspicious from our examination of the body," police Lt. John Geyerman said, referring to the cause of death.

The victim did not have ties to the high school, Geyerman said.
